Gualala Lumber Mill
- Type: Sign
- Inscription: “This mill was at the bend in the Gualala River. Large redwoods were transported from the surrounding forests to the mill by oxen teams, train and the river itself. Milled lumber was then taken by train tow miles north to Bourn’s Landing and shipped by sma”
